Hotel Heron Joins Curio Collection by Hilton
Hotel Heron, a property operated by Aparium Group, has announced its transition to Curio Collection by Hilton. The 134-room hotel will continue to be managed by Aparium and will maintain its independent identity while becoming part of Hilton’s global portfolio.

Located in Alexandria, Virginia, Hotel Heron becomes the second Curio Collection by Hilton property in the DMV region. The move reflects an expansion of the hotel’s market reach while preserving its focus on local connections and neighborhood engagement.
As part of Curio Collection by Hilton, the new property will participate in Hilton Honors, providing guests access to member benefits such as Digital Key, points-based payment options, member-only rates, and complimentary Wi-Fi.

Situated in Old Town Alexandria, the hotel offers a contemporary perspective on the historic neighborhood. Its on-site food and beverage venues include KILN, a ground-floor restaurant featuring hearth-inspired Mid-Atlantic cuisine; Francis Hall, a cocktail bar located within the hotel; and Good Fortune, a rooftop venue offering views of the Potomac River.

With its addition to Curio Collection by Hilton, Hotel Heron enters a new phase while continuing to emphasize design, community-oriented programming, and locally influenced dining experiences.
